The Quality: Crisp Details (No Pixelation Here)

We’ve all had that fear of buying a digital download, printing it out, and realizing it looks like a blurry mess from 2005.
I checked the specs on this listing, and it is solid.
Resolution: 300 DPI (Dots Per Inch). In non-tech speak, that means it prints at professional gallery quality.
Format: It comes as a PNG file, which preserves quality better than a compressed JPEG.
Because the file is high-res, you can see the individual whiskers on the cub and the ice crystals on the cave walls. It looks expensive, even though the file itself is a steal.
